I've said elsewhere that I am reading his biog. "Under No Illusion" at the moment (very good it is too) and just have to relate this to you as I was on the bog at the time, which I nearly fell off as I was laughing so much. Thank God I wasn't reading it on the train or bus as people would think I was a nutter, but you know how it is when something just catches you..................................anyway, I digress:-

So, if you can imagine one of these smoky small working men's clubs that were rife in the 60s/early 70s a la "Wheeltappers and Shunters" and Paul was working one. He was called by his real name then, Ted Daniels and for some reason it was always getting mispronounced as one word Tedaniels or Ted d d d daniels which the compere stuttered and struggled with; BUT he writes, this was nothing compared to a very good singing duo he saw called Les Pollux and he heard the compere announce them as Les (as in the man's name) Bollox. One of the duo drew the compere's attention to the fact that it's pronounced, "Lay" and that there were two of them, at which point the (presumably half cut) compere turned back to the microphone and announced them as the "Two Bollocks".
